一尘不染

在远程Teamcity构建代理上运行selenium自动化测试

selenium

最近,我们开始使用Teamcity进行构建管理,并使用ANT脚本运行selenium
junit测试。测试成功运行,并显示为在teamcity控制台上通过。如果我登录到构建代理机器,则在运行测试时,我期望能够看到浏览器窗口打开并且填充和提交字段。我没有看到Firefox浏览器窗口打开,想知道我的测试如何通过。当我在Eclipse中运行相同的测试脚本时,将打开Firefox浏览器窗口,并填充网页字段。

感谢您的评论。


阅读 408

收藏
2020-06-26

共1个答案

一尘不染

因为TeamCity构建代理是作为Windows服务运行的。因此,您将无法看到实际的GUI。

如果要更改它,请更改您的构建代理安装。

2020-06-26